Getting a new car is always exciting—even if it’s pre-owned. However, buying a used vehicle can often feel like a gamble. How do you know for sure that it isn’t a lemon? Does it have hidden damage from an accident or other problems that you’ll have to worry about once it’s yours?

One step you can take is to order a report from a vehicle history service. This can help to uncover title problems, serious accidents, or flood damage, as well as any recall notices for the vehicle. Although reviewing maintenance and repair records are always helpful, many sellers don’t keep them.

A vehicle history report can tell you a lot about major events or damage that happened to the car, but they won’t necessarily tell you what you really want to know: the long-term reliability of the vehicle. No one wants to buy a used car that will bring endless repair costs.

The best way to ensure your investment is well spent is to have our technicians perform an inspection. A used vehicle inspection (or buyer’s inspection) will go a lot deeper than how the vehicle looks and drives. For example, some of the things we’ll check during an inspection include:

  • Engine
  • Transmission
  • Brakes
  • Radiator
  • Fluids (level and condition)
  • Lights
  • Suspension
  • Hoses
  • Air conditioning
  • Exhaust
  • Abnormal sounds
  • Tire wear
  • Rust
  • Frame damage

With our thorough inspection, you’ll know whether the seller is being honest about the vehicle and if it’s worth investing in. You’ll get an idea of its overall condition, the status of its major safety systems, and how well it’s been maintained. You’ll find out what type of work it needs, which can help you determine the value of the vehicle and whether the seller’s price is reasonable.

A used vehicle inspection is well worth the cost because if serious problems are found, you can either negotiate a lower price or decide not to purchase the car. If everything on the car looks good, you have a plan for addressing any routine services, not to mention peace of mind that you’re making a good purchase.
